Why the Cropped Jacket Works for Every Body Type

The cropped cut creates a natural waist definition without requiring a belt or cinching. For those who prefer not to tuck in their tops, a cropped jacket achieves the same effect — it visually marks the waist and elongates the legs. The key is proportionality: pair a very cropped jacket (ending above the navel) with high-waisted bottoms to avoid exposing too much midriff, or choose a jacket that hits just at the hip for a more relaxed, covered look. Either approach works well when the volumes are balanced.

On petite frames, cropped jackets are particularly effective because they avoid overwhelming the silhouette the way an oversized coat might. On taller builds, they allow for more dramatic proportion play — try a very boxy, cropped style over a long, flowing skirt for a strong contrast that reads as editorial rather than accidental.

The Classic Pairing: Cropped Jacket and High-Waisted Trousers

The most universally flattering combination for a cropped jacket is with high-waisted, wide-leg trousers. The high rise of the trousers meets the hem of the jacket seamlessly, creating a continuous line from shoulder to foot. Choose matching fabrics for a co-ord effect — a matching linen jacket and trouser set in a neutral tone is a go-to for summer dressing, as featured regularly in Harper’s Bazaar street style coverage. For a more eclectic approach, mix textures — a cropped leather jacket over tailored wool trousers creates an interesting contrast of formal and edge.

When wearing a cropped jacket with trousers, consider what you wear underneath. A simple fitted t-shirt or ribbed tank keeps the focus on the jacket’s silhouette. A silk blouse tucked into the trousers adds polish for office or evening wear. Avoid bulky knitwear underneath a structured cropped jacket as it disrupts the clean lines — save that combination for more relaxed bomber styles.

How to Wear a Cropped Jacket with Dresses

Layering a cropped jacket over a dress is one of the easiest ways to transition a summer look into cooler months. A floral midi dress paired with a tailored cropped blazer in a complementary neutral transforms the outfit from purely seasonal to year-round. The jacket adds structure and warmth without obscuring the dress beneath. Style editors at Elle consistently note that this pairing works best when the jacket and dress share at least one colour reference — it creates cohesion without matchy-matchy monotony.

For evening, try a cropped velvet jacket over a slip dress. The contrast of the jacket’s structure with the fluid movement of the slip creates a deliberately sophisticated tension that is more interesting than either piece worn alone. Keep accessories minimal — simple earrings and a small clutch let the outfit speak for itself.

Cropped Jackets in Autumn and Winter

A cropped jacket alone rarely provides sufficient warmth in cold weather, but layered strategically, it becomes a viable winter piece. The trick is to treat it as a mid-layer rather than an outer layer. Wear a cropped leather jacket over a thick roll-neck knit and under a longline coat — the knit provides warmth, the jacket adds edge, and the coat handles weather protection. Alternatively, a cropped padded jacket works as outerwear in milder temperatures when paired with a heavyweight knit and thermal base layer.

In autumn specifically, cropped jackets in tweed, boucle, or wool blends are strong seasonal choices. These fabrics have enough weight to feel appropriate for the season while the cropped cut keeps the look fresh rather than heavy. A cream boucle cropped jacket with straight-leg dark jeans and loafers is a clean, seasonally appropriate outfit that works across casual and semi-formal settings.

Styling a Cropped Jacket for Spring and Summer

In warmer months, lighter fabrics make the cropped jacket genuinely wearable as outerwear. Linen, cotton, and lightweight denim are the natural choices. A cropped denim jacket is arguably one of the most worn pieces in warm-weather casual dressing — pair it with a sundress or with shorts and a basic tee for a relaxed but considered look. For spring evenings when temperatures drop, a cropped linen blazer over a camisole and wide-leg jeans hits the right note of polished and comfortable without being overdressed.

Common Styling Mistakes to Avoid

The most common error with cropped jackets is pairing them with low-rise bottoms. If the jacket ends at or above the navel and the trousers sit at the hip, the resulting gap of visible midriff can feel unintentional. The fix is simple: ensure the bottom half is mid-rise or above, or choose a slightly longer cropped style that bridges the gap. The second frequent mistake is choosing a jacket that is too small in the shoulders in an attempt to achieve a cropped length — always size for the shoulders and shorten the body if needed.

A cropped jacket worn open almost always looks better than one that is buttoned or zipped up tight, as the open style allows the underneath layer and the bottom half to be visible simultaneously, creating a more dynamic outfit composition.
